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Winchester to Kelvindale start from £151.90 one way, or £217.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Winchester to Kelvindale are available for £159.50 one way, or £319.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

Winchester train station is equipped with various amenities to ensure your journey is as comfortable as possible. Buying tickets is a breeze with the ticket office open from early morning to late evening, seven days a week. If you've pre-booked your tickets online, you can easily collect them from one of the accessible ticket machines on site. Benefit from the option to use smartcards, which are available for both issuance and validation at the station.

For passengers requiring assistance, staff help is readily available throughout operational hours. The station provides step-free access to all platforms, accommodating those with mobility impairments. There's also a heated waiting room on platform 2 complete with seating that aligns with the Code of Practice, making waits much more pleasant.

When hunger strikes, enjoy a cup of coffee or a quick snack at one of the onsite refreshment facilities like Costa Coffee or the Pumpkin Café. Plus, those who prefer cycling can take advantage of the secure cycle hub available at the station, which provides a large number of spaces and round-the-clock access.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Kelvindale train station might not boast luxury amenities, but it offers the basics for a comfortable travel experience. It’s a Category A station, meaning there is step-free access throughout, making it suitable for individuals requiring assistance. Unfortunately, you won’t find ticket offices or machines here, so it’s best to buy your tickets online before arriving. While there’s a seating area for your comfort, there are no toilet facilities, shops, or refreshment services available on-site.

For those needing assistance, help is available via a help point and departure screens ensure you keep track of your train journey. For any enquiries, contact ScotRail Customer Relations. Luggage services and bicycle storage are limited, so plan accordingly if you are traveling with extra gear.

Onward Travel from Kelvindale

Kelvindale station ensures onward travel is a breeze despite its compact size. For bus travel, services pick up and drop off outside the station on Cleveden Road. Visit Travel Line Scotland for detailed bus schedules. For taxi services, Train Taxi provides information on local taxi hires.
